It is a phrase in similar form to Go Fuck Yourself or Suck Your Nan. It can also be used in a more literal sense if your Mum is an actual SCHLAAAAGGG!!!!
"Hey shopkeeper, have you got twenty Bensons"


"Oh Dick on your Mum"

"What did you say?"

"Fucking double Dick on your Mum"

"You shouldn't say that!!"

"African Elephant Dick on your Mum!!!!
by YaNansPumsDead March 29, 2013